Job Summary
The Campus Pastor serves as the spiritual leader of the congregation, guiding and nurturing the church community through teaching, preaching, and pastoral care. This role requires a compassionate individual with strong leadership skills who can effectively communicate and educate members on spiritual matters. The Senior Pastor will also be responsible for crisis management and providing bereavement support to those in need.
Responsibilities
- Lead worship services, delivering engaging sermons that inspire and educate the congregation.
- Provide pastoral care, including crisis intervention and hospice care for individuals and families during difficult times.
- Offer bereavement support to grieving families, helping them navigate their loss with compassion and understanding.
- Communicate effectively with church members, fostering an open environment for discussion and spiritual growth.
- Manage conflicts within the congregation with sensitivity and professionalism, promoting reconciliation and unity.
- Oversee church programs and activities, ensuring they align with the mission and vision of the church.
- Mentor church staff and volunteers, providing guidance in their personal and spiritual development.
- Write newsletters, articles, or other communications to keep the congregation informed about church activities and initiatives.
Qualifications
- A degree in Theology or a related field is preferred; ordination as a minister is required.
- Proven leadership experience within a church or community setting.
- Strong crisis management skills with the ability to respond effectively in high-pressure situations.
-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with an ability to present complex ideas clearly.
- Experience in conflict management, demonstrating an ability to mediate disputes effectively.
- Compassionate approach to hospice care and bereavement support, showing empathy towards individuals in distress.
- A commitment to ongoing personal spiritual growth and professional development within ministry practices.
